RAMSTEIN AIR BASE, Germany — Two airmen were taken to hospitals after being injured Friday while driving in a personal vehicle on a base road, according to an 86th Airlift Wing statement.

The driver was taken to Landstuhl Regional Medical Center, and the passenger was transported to a local German hospital. Both airmen are assigned to the 86th Munitions Squadron, the statement said.

Officials did not provide details about the extent of the injuries or the nature of what the statement referred to as an incident. The cause is under investigation.
